German cockroach egg cases are typically about a quarter-inch long and less than half that in width, while American cockroaches lay egg sacs that are about a half-inch long and a quarter-inch wide. The majority of cockroaches are oviparous, meaning the eggs develop outside of the mother instead of inside.
